Étape 3: Configuration de l’environnement de développement
Même pour ordinateur pas très expérimenté spécialiste devrait être facile de configurer l’environnement de développement.
Mais avant cela, il faut installer un pilote pour le programmateur ISP qui sera utilisé pour télécharger les programmes que nous créons le microcontrôleur. Le programmeur qui est utilisé ici est appelé USBasp et sa page d’accueil est à http://www.fischl.de/usbasp/. Le pilote pour MS Windows est disponible sur le site même.
Le programmeur USBasp lui-même pourrait être acheté provenant de divers endroits - eBay, etc.. Il fait également partie du kit de démarrage de Tinusaur qui est disponible sur le site Web Tinusaur.
Maintenant - l’environnement de développement. On l’appelle WinAVR. Son site Web est disponible à cette adresse : http://winavr.sourceforge.net/.
Fondamentalement, c’est...
- le SDK - Voici le compilateur C/C++ et les bibliothèques ;
- d’autres outils qui aident à construire le programme, converti en un format binaire et l’Uploader sur le microcontrôleur.
Il n’y a aucun éditeur de texte intégré - un tel pourrait être utilisé. Norepad ++ est un bon choix.
Le bâtiment est fait à la commande en utilisant le faire command et fichier appelé Makefile.
Des instructions plus détaillées, comment mettre en place le WinAVR sont disponibles à la page guides de Tinusaur : http://tinusaur.org/guides/winavr-setup-guide/. Là, vous pouvez également trouver quelques tests qui vous aideront à savoir si l’installation était correcte.